Housing Stock in Puck city Municipality 2020
In 2020, Puck city municipality ranked 844 of 2,478 Polish municipalities. Dwelling stock grew by 369 units +9.32% between 2015-2020, reaching 4,329.
Among 494 growing municipalities, ranked in top 20% for housing growth rate. Within Pucki county, ranked 5 of 7 municipalities. In Pomeranian province, ranked 56.
Based on 31 years of official GUS housing market statistics for Pucki county municipalities within Pomeranian province.
